When I'm compiling CDs, it's either of a specific artist, or a various artists compilation. Either way, the two most important songs will always be the 'opener' and the 'closer'.
I try to choose songs that give the right feel for that artist's style, or the mood of the overall album.

For example :~
My Jimi Hendrix comp opened with 'All Along the Watchtower', and closed with 'Voodoo Chile {Slight Return}'

The Who opens on 'I Can't Explain', and closes with 'Won't Get Fooled Again'.

I made a point of closing disc 1 of my Robert Palmer album with 'Sneakin' Sally Through the Alley', because of the way it ends, and opening disc 2 with 'Mama Talk to Your Daughter' because of the way it starts!

One of my VA comps opens with 'Magic Bus' {The Who}, and closes on 'Waterloo Sunset' {The Kinks}.
Another opens on 'Born to Be Wild' {Steppenwolf} and ends on 'Time Has Told Me' {Nick Drake}.

Well when I'm making a mix I usually try to make the songs flow into one another and most of the time I slow the end of the cd down to give you that closure feeling and the perfect song to end the mix is A Perfect Circle's "Brena" it's such a soft beuatiful song which is a great way close out a moving mix.
